I have a major issue. I was served papers for Divorce from my wife who was just convicted of Domestic Assault and has a history of Violence. I am still at the house with our two children and I need to answer this divorce summons. My problem is Monroe Michigan only has one legal Aid office and they will not take me as I am a conflict since she went to them. She is working and has a job and I am on unemployment and make less than she does. I cannot find anyone who can help as to what I can do to retain an Attorney. I am the primary caregiver of the chlildren and I need to keep them here and she is a danger to them and me. Is there anyone who can let me know where and how I can get an attorney pro bono or legal aid somewhere else? All my income now goes to the care of the house and children. Any help would be greatly appreciated. I have called all the pro bono and legal aid numbers and they all seem to be a part of the same group. I need to get this taken care of ASAP!

If you are unable to borrow money anywhere to hire an attorney, you may have to represent yourself. You would need to learn the local rules and proceedures and submit your own response.
